What Is a Blooket Bot?

A Blooket bot is essentially an automated participant intended to interact with a Blooket game. A normal student joins a session, chooses or receives a nickname, answers questions, and interacts with the game manually. A bot attempts to automate some or all of those actions through software rather than relying on a person to perform them.

The word “bot” is short for robot, but in this context it does not necessarily mean a physical machine. It usually means a computer program capable of performing repetitive online actions. Similar concepts exist across many websites and games, including automated chat accounts, testing programs, and software used to simulate users. The underlying technology can be interesting from a programming perspective even when its use in a classroom game is inappropriate.

There is also an important distinction between educational automation and disruptive automation. Developers sometimes create automated clients for legitimate testing purposes, such as checking whether a system can handle multiple connections or identifying weaknesses in an application. Using automation to interfere with a real classroom session, however, is a different matter. It can affect other participants and undermine the purpose of the activity.

How Blooket Bots Generally Work

At a high level, automated web tools typically work by imitating actions that a normal browser user would perform. A program may communicate with a website, send information to a server, receive responses, and process those responses automatically. This is a common concept in software development and is not unique to Blooket.

The technical details can vary considerably depending on how a website is designed. Modern web applications may use ordinary HTTP requests, browser scripts, real-time connections, authentication systems, session identifiers, and other mechanisms. An automation program would need to understand at least some of the communication expected by the application before it could imitate a legitimate user.

That does not mean every Blooket bot found online can actually perform these actions successfully. Websites change over time, and automation methods can stop working after an update. A script created for an older version of a platform may simply fail, produce errors, or behave unpredictably. This is one reason users should be cautious about websites claiming to offer a “working” bot without explaining what the software actually does.

Are Blooket Bots Safe to Use?

Safety is one of the biggest concerns surrounding third-party Blooket bot tools. A random website offering an automated service may ask users to install browser extensions, download executable files, paste scripts into developer tools, or provide information that should remain private. None of those requests should automatically be trusted.

A particularly important warning sign is a tool that asks for account credentials. Students should never assume that entering a username and password into an unofficial website is necessary just because the site claims to provide a Blooket feature. Giving credentials to an unknown service can create risks that have nothing to do with the original game.

Downloads deserve similar caution. A small script can look harmless while hiding unwanted behavior, and browser extensions can potentially request extensive permissions. If the goal is simply to participate in an educational quiz, installing questionable software is rarely worth the risk. Keeping your device secure is much more important than experimenting with an unofficial automation tool.

Legitimate Uses of Automation for Learning

Automation itself is not bad. In fact, it is an important part of modern technology. Programmers use automation to test websites, monitor systems, process information, perform repetitive tasks, and evaluate how applications respond under different conditions. The key issue is authorization and purpose.

If you are interested in learning how bots work, you can build a small educational project that you completely control. For example, a beginner could create a simple quiz application and then write a program that interacts with that application. This approach teaches many of the same concepts while avoiding interference with someone else’s platform.

Another useful project is a mock multiplayer environment. You could create a basic webpage with several simulated players and experiment with how automated clients connect, receive questions, and submit answers. This is an excellent way to learn about requests, responses, event handling, data structures, and basic web programming without putting a real classroom session at risk.

How Teachers Can Handle Suspicious Bot Activity

Teachers who notice unusual activity during a Blooket session should first avoid assuming that every unexpected participant is deliberately causing trouble. Technical errors, duplicate sessions, and misunderstandings can sometimes produce strange results. A calm investigation is usually more effective than immediately blaming a student.

If deliberate automation is suspected, the teacher can review the available session information and consider the platform’s current controls and guidance. Keeping classroom game codes private and sharing them only with intended participants can also reduce unnecessary access. Teachers should use the platform’s own security and moderation features where available rather than relying on unofficial tools.

It is also useful to explain the reason behind the rules. Students are more likely to respect restrictions when they understand that the goal is to protect lesson time, fairness, privacy, and the experience of their classmates. A short conversation about responsible technology use can turn a frustrating incident into a useful digital-literacy lesson.

Common Misconceptions About Blooket Bots

One common misconception is that every Blooket bot is automatically a harmless joke. In reality, the effect depends on what the automation does and where it is used. A private experiment on a developer’s own application is very different from interfering with a live classroom game.

Another misconception is that an online bot tool must be legitimate simply because it appears in search results. Search engines can index pages containing outdated scripts, misleading claims, aggressive advertisements, or potentially unsafe downloads. Visibility does not equal trustworthiness.

It is also incorrect to assume that automation will always work. Online platforms are continuously updated, and changes to their systems can make old scripts unusable. Even when a tool appears to function, it may violate platform rules or create security concerns. Responsible users should evaluate the purpose, permissions, risks, and authorization before running third-party software.
